作者: 董城,李嘉梁 "嘿,快瞧,机器狗跟咱拜年呢!"大年初一,第三十八届地坛春节文化庙会如约而至。舞台上,3只披 着舞狮装扮的机器狗依次抬起前腿,随着音乐的节奏上下摆动,向四方游客送上新春祝福。 来源:光明日报 庙会中心的银河太空舱机器人零售店前围满顾客,从总台春晚走入市民生活的"机器人店主"将一杯杯热 腾腾的咖啡递到取餐口前。AR打卡、数字互动等体验点遍布园区,在传统民俗与现代科技的碰撞融合 中年味更显新趣。零售店旁的展厅里,数字孪生元宇宙庙会平台打破时空限制,与北京龙潭庙会联动, 实现365天全时运营。民众只需动动手指,即可沉浸式感受庙会氛围。 龙潭庙会开幕式上,传统醒狮纳福与国潮龙王机甲巡游相映成趣;"潮朝阳·潮庙会"系列新春活动,让 古老的东岳庙散发现代活力,"北京首个熊猫街"成为开放式新春乐园;海淀新春科技庙会则齐聚"硬 核"展品,专业乐团携手机器人乐队奏响新春乐章……智慧赋能,古韵新声,京城庙会正不断潮起来。 ...
【能源广角】5万亿元电网投资要用在刀刃上
Sou Hu Cai Jing· 2026-02-19 23:16
Group 1 - The State Grid has announced a 4 trillion yuan investment plan, representing a 40% increase compared to the "14th Five-Year Plan" [2] - The total investment in the power grid during the "15th Five-Year Plan" period is expected to exceed 5 trillion yuan, driven by investments from the Southern Power Grid and local power companies [2] - Increasing investment in the power grid is a strategic move to strengthen national energy security amid global energy supply fluctuations and rising demand for electricity from artificial intelligence [2] Group 2 - The investment is crucial for achieving the "dual carbon" goals and promoting green transformation, as the power grid is essential for the large-scale integration and efficient consumption of renewable energy [2][3] - By 2030, the goal is to establish a new type of power grid platform that includes a backbone grid and distribution networks, supported by smart microgrids [3] - The investment plan focuses on three main areas: upgrading ultra-high voltage power lines, improving urban and rural distribution networks, and developing a smart grid using advanced technologies like AI and digital twins [3] Group 3 - The substantial investment is expected to yield multiple benefits, but it is essential to ensure that funds are allocated effectively [4] - There is a need to avoid an overemphasis on hardware while neglecting software systems and market mechanisms, ensuring a coordinated development of both [4] - The investment structure should be optimized, and costs controlled to prevent unreasonable investments from being passed on to electricity prices, while prioritizing improvements in electricity access for underprivileged areas [4]
新春走基层 | 深海一号海底钻云上算
Xin Lang Cai Jing· 2026-02-18 23:26
Core Viewpoint - The article highlights the advancements and operational efficiency of the "Deep Sea One" gas field platform, emphasizing the importance of domestic technology and innovation in enhancing energy security and production capabilities in China's deep-sea oil and gas sector [1][2][4]. Group 1: Technology and Innovation - The "Deep Sea One" platform utilizes 16 mooring lines, each enduring a pull of 300 to 400 tons, ensuring stability in the ocean [2]. - The platform has achieved complete domestic production of mooring cables, which were previously imported, showcasing significant advancements in local manufacturing capabilities [2]. - The team has developed a fully autonomous system for monitoring and managing hydrate blockages, enhancing operational efficiency [3]. Group 2: Operational Efficiency - The platform has supplied over 14 billion cubic meters of gas since its inception, contributing to both the Hainan Free Trade Port and the Guangdong-Hong Kong-Macao Greater Bay Area [4]. - The implementation of "smart completion" technology has improved drilling efficiency by 30%, allowing for real-time monitoring and remote control of drilling operations [3]. - The integration of digital twin technology and AI algorithms has led to a 40% reduction in energy consumption per unit of output [3]. Group 3: Strategic Importance - The development of the "Deep Sea One" gas field is positioned as a strategic initiative to enhance China's energy self-sufficiency and security [2]. - The platform is recognized as the starting point for China's deep-sea oil and gas exploration, marking a significant milestone in the industry [4].

“海陆空”全域覆盖,数字孪生赋能港珠澳大桥智慧运维
2 1 Shi Ji Jing Ji Bao Dao· 2026-02-15 04:11
Core Insights - The Hong Kong-Zhuhai-Macao Bridge experienced a significant increase in traffic during the Spring Festival, with approximately 158,200 vehicle trips from February 2 to February 11, marking a year-on-year growth of 26.51% since its opening in October 2018 [1] Group 1: Digital Infrastructure and Smart Operations - The bridge's operations are supported by a comprehensive smart operation and maintenance system that integrates "sea, land, and air" technologies, utilizing a digital twin model to monitor real-time data and structural health [1][2] - The smart operation system includes a full-chain intelligent maintenance demonstration that covers six categories of data standards, facilitating cross-business data integration [2] - A network of 1,000 sensors provides real-time calculations, alerts, and visualization of key indicators, ensuring continuous monitoring of the bridge's health [2][3] Group 2: Technological Advancements and Innovations - The development of 13 sets of unmanned inspection equipment, including underwater drones and robots, enhances the ability to detect and assess structural conditions, particularly in underwater environments [3] - The smart operation platform acts as the "brain" of the bridge, creating a three-dimensional detection network for comprehensive structural health monitoring [3] Group 3: Regional Innovation and Collaboration - The digital engineering and maintenance of the bridge exemplify the collaborative innovation efforts within the Guangdong-Hong Kong-Macao Greater Bay Area, with a focus on shared standards and resources [4] - The establishment of the Guangdong-Hong Kong Marine Infrastructure Joint Laboratory aims to address challenges in marine engineering materials and design, promoting regional technological integration [4][5] - The laboratory will enhance real-time monitoring and risk assessment for the bridge, contributing to the safety and durability of major marine infrastructure [5]
“陆空联合”保障春运供电
Xin Lang Cai Jing· 2026-02-14 21:57
Group 1 - The core idea of the articles highlights the advancements in technology, particularly the use of drones and digital twin technology, in enhancing the efficiency and safety of power supply operations during critical periods like the Spring Festival travel rush [1][2] - The 220 kV Shoushan Substation has become one of the first digital twin substations developed by the State Grid, utilizing vast amounts of data to create a digital representation of its equipment [2] - The introduction of drone inspections allows for coverage of 1,224.6 kilometers of transmission lines and 3,198.08 kilometers of distribution lines, significantly increasing operational efficiency compared to traditional methods [2] Group 2 - The drone's "frog jump" capability enables it to autonomously move between substations, charging at designated stations, thus streamlining the inspection process [1][2] - The integration of a four-legged robotic dog for ground inspections complements the drone's aerial capabilities, forming a combined land and air inspection system [2] - The transformation from manual inspections to technology-driven methods reflects the commitment of power industry personnel to maintain reliable electricity supply [1][2]
法国达索系统集团在越设立人工智能与数字孪生研发卓越中心
Shang Wu Bu Wang Zhan· 2026-02-14 15:59
Core Viewpoint - The establishment of the Artificial Intelligence and Digital Twin Research and Excellence Center by Dassault Systèmes in Vietnam is strategically significant for enhancing the country's technological capabilities [1] Group 1: Strategic Importance - The center's establishment reflects the commitment of the Vietnamese government to collaborate with leading global technology groups, showcasing increasing confidence from French and European partners in Vietnam's investment environment and long-term development vision in strategic technology sectors [1] - Collaborating with top technology groups will help Vietnam rapidly acquire advanced technologies, promote knowledge transfer, and develop high-quality human resources, gradually forming a localized ecosystem for artificial intelligence and digital twins [1] Group 2: Focus Areas and Goals - The center will initially focus on the aerospace sector, with plans to expand into semiconductors, transportation, and new mobility models [1] - The center aims not only to develop advanced technological solutions but also to emphasize knowledge transfer and the cultivation of high-quality human resources, enhancing the global competitiveness of Vietnamese enterprises [1]
